搜尋

首頁  >  問答  >  主體

選擇按日期分組的行

我想從按日期分組的表格中選擇標題(和 ID-s),但如下所示。

左側單元格是ID 右側單元格是標題 中間單元格是日期

#從新聞分組中按日期順序選擇ID標題日期 BY 日期 DESC;

P粉729436537P粉729436537440 天前613

全部回覆(1)我來回復

  • P粉738046172

    P粉7380461722023-09-13 09:16:35

    要在 MySQL 中將按值分組顯示為標頭,您可以將 GROUP_CONCAT 函數與 CONCAT 函數結合使用,將分組值與字串連接。下面是一個查詢範例:

    SELECT CONCAT('Group:', group_column) AS header, COUNT(*) AS count
    FROM your_table
    GROUP BY group_column;

    在此查詢中,將 group_column 替換為要分組的列的名稱,將 your_table 替換為表格的名稱。 CONCAT 函數將字串「Group:」與 group_column 的值組合起來以建立標頭。 COUNT 函數用於計算每個群組中的行數。

    這將產生一個包含兩個欄位的結果集:標題列和計數列。標題列將顯示與字串「Group:」連接的群組值。

    回覆
    0
  • 取消回覆